criticism vs. cynicism →
Criticism is doubt informed by curiosity and a deep knowledge of a discipline related to your work. Whether the criticism you receive is constructive or not, it comes from knowledge. By contrast, cynicism is a form of doubt resulting from ignorance and antiquated ways.
